Do you have safe and stable shelter—an affordable place to “go home to” each night? SARA has three residential programs to serve women in Abbotsford and Mission, BC.

Vulnerable women and children in the Fraser Valley can live safe and stable lives and have access to counselling, outreach supports, and many unique programs at this 41-unit, supported second-stage housing program in Abbotsford.

Santa Rosa Place is a home for women and their children from Mission or Abbotsford. Thirteen self-contained units make up this second-stage transitional housing program located in downtown Mission. Women who live at Santa Rosa Place are alcohol and drug-free.

Penny’s Place in Abbotsford is a first-stage housing program that is home to six women who may be active in an addiction, experiencing mental health concerns, and/or be street engaged. Each resident has her own room with a locking door and shares common areas of the house. A house facilitator lives on site and provides support to the women who live at Penny’s Place. Substance use, smoking, or guests are not allowed in this home.
